.Head Of State Droupadi Murmu (PTI Photo) 2 minutes read Last Updated: Aug 21 2024|12:20 AM IST.President Droupadi Murmu on Tuesday provided the National Geoscience Awards (NGA) for 2023 to 21 geoscientists, including academicians as well as professionals from across the nation.The awards, completing 12, identified superior accomplishments in geosciences, mineral expedition, and natural hazard examinations. The President stressed the necessity for independence in mineral manufacturing to obtain India's objective of becoming an industrialized country by 2047.The recipients were actually honoured in 3 groups: National Geoscience Award for Life-time Achievement, National Geoscience Award, and National Youthful Geoscientist Honor.Prof Dhiraj Mohan Banerjee got the Lifetime Success Honor for his lead-in deal with phosphorites, isotope geology, as well as all natural geochemistry. Dr Ashutosh Pandey was granted the National Young Geoscientist Award for his groundbreaking investigation on the geodynamic progression of the Eastern Dharwar Craton.The Head of state additionally showed assurance that the government's initiatives, featuring the National Geoscience Data Storehouse Gateway and also using emerging modern technologies, will definitely aid India understand its own organic riches much better and use it correctly.While highlighting the value of geoscience in nation-building, Minister of Charcoal as well as Mines G Kishan said that the award resides in line with the goal of 'Viksit Bharat 2047'.Reddy reiterated the authorities's devotion to enriching the exploration sector through various reforms, consisting of modifications to the Mines as well as Minerals (Growth as well as Rule) Act.The modifications in the MMDR Act in 2023 have actually encouraged the central government to auction 24 crucial and also strategic minerals. As of August twenty, the Department of Mines has auctioned 14 such blocks so far.He additionally incorporated that to speed up expedition in the nation, the Department of Mines has just recently offered the exploration permit for 29 deep-rooted minerals. Reddy additionally highlighted the recent news in the 2024 Allocate putting together the Critical Mineral Objective, which is a substantial measure towards getting the source establishment of these vital minerals.He stressed the fostering of arising modern technologies like AI as well as machine learning in mineral discovery as well as exploration.V L Kantha Rao, secretary, Administrative agency of Mines, talked about the evolution of the National Geoscience Awards given that their beginning in 1966, keeping in mind the development of the awards to feature brand-new geoscience domains.First Released: Aug 21 2024|12:20 AM IST.
